Transaction 25f814984ded968b429a75a3b15532ff381312161200f585dc00255d646a2098
1 Input
1 Output
-
25f814984ded968b429a75a3b15532ff381312161200f585dc00255d646a2098:0
- value
- 2288407
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0517ccb0d794eede9ea686e9ec7951730e305d04 OP_EQUAL
- address
- 329wp8GycZ3TUwKtCNVCjBAfbKF8jvGYYE